Please select your home edition
Edition
Sydney International Boat Show 2024

China Cup International Regatta 2017

© CCIR / Studio Borlenghi
China Cup International Regatta 2017 photo copyright CCIR / Studio Borlenghi taken at  and featuring the IRC class
IRC
37th AC Store 2024-two-728X90 BOTTOMSydney International Boat Show 2024HALLSPARS_BOOMS_SW_728X99-lot-99 BOTTOM